Output 592d240efd282e130dadcbe2d214e28d86bac2dad52f193d8892d953633c43c2:5

value
38985623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ab5bd4c269f7f465135f51baa06b48a720f2d0f OP_EQUAL
address
MBnzKxvMyvh9cMi1whguc9516j1Y9a58za
transaction
592d240efd282e130dadcbe2d214e28d86bac2dad52f193d8892d953633c43c2
spent
true